This page contains some ideas about future refactorization of libavogadro. They may seriously break ABI (and possibly API), and should be discussed

Rendering Widget

  • Make libavogadro use abstract RenderWidget instead of GLWidget
  • Inherit GLWidget from RenderWidget and QGLWidget, move GL-independent functionality (e.g., plugin access) up to RenderWidget
  • Remove any OpenGL calls from engines, replace them by new methods of PainterDevice
  • Add minimalistic SimpleRenderWidget without OpenGL (to create images for publication, b/w images, for use on old/heavy loaded PCs, etc)
  • Create separate GLWidgets for OpenGL2, 3, 4, etc (?)
  • "On-line" POV-Ray rendering for aesthetes (???)

PlotWidget

  • Make it stronger and used by 3rd party developers - I think there are some projects interested in easy Qt way to do it without linking to KDE
  • Rename it to QPlotWidget and publish as independent library - may be some contributors will appear
  • KPlotWidget is LGPL, so we can change its license to LGPL
  • Try to merge KPlotWidget with QPlotWIdget
    • KPlotWidget didn't evolve a lot from time it was forked for Avogadro
    • so it could be simple KDE wrapper for QPlotWidget library and some KDE-specific features
    • [crazy idea] We can try to push QPlotWidget in QtGui, and KDE folks will do all work theirselves :)

Modularization of libavogadro

Libavogadro contains a lot of APIs for different purposes and tends to grow. I propose to divide it into several modules (as Qt did when moving to Qt4)

For compatibility with previous versions, dummy libavogadro library linked to all components could be provided

AvogadroCore

Generic classes which could be used even by terminal applications to simplify access to OB and make some advanced operations with molecules.

Also, it's needed to create class AvogadroWidget which will allow to choose what subclass of RenderWidget is used

AvogadroPython should be made "optional" - while Avogadro is compiled with Python support, it should work without AvogadroPython library and load it if it's present (for Linux packaging). Maybe it can be loaded as a plugin.

Source Tree

Current source tree is very complicated and "overpopulated". Extensions directory looks like a dump.

  • Divide libavogadro and avogadro repositories, create a superpckage instead. It isn't actual now, but if ABI is stable, application and library releases may be done separately, especially bugfix ones. What about Windows and Mac users? They may receive such bugfixes as incremental updates (e.g., download only avogadro.exe through update manager instead of full installation procedure for new release)
  • Divide extensions into:
    • Main - live in Git of (lib)avogadro (e.g., animationextension,cartesianextension, fileimportextension, networkfetchextension, propextension, selectextension)
    • Extras:
      • Quantum - input generators, MO surfaces, basis set code
      • Crystal - unitcell, supercell (?)
      • Spectra

Of course, everything could be built together as superpackage
